A couple of notes: For a little added crunch factor, I topped these bars with some leftover raisin bran crumbs, found at the bottom of a near empty bag. If you don’t have any, simply omit it. I also used vanilla protein powder (I use Whole Foods brand whey protein). If you don’t have any, substitute the 1/4 cup for 1/4 cup of whole wheat flour.
Oatmeal Protein Bars
Ingredients
1/4 cup brown sugar
1/4 cup honey
1/4 cup plain yogurt
1 mashed banana
1 egg
1 tbsp. canola oil
1 tbsp. milk (or water)
1/4 cup vanilla protein powder (I use whey)
1/2 cup whole wheat flour
1-1/2 cups oatmeal
1/2 cup raisins (some nuts would be good too – I just didn’t have any)
1 tsp. cinnamon
1 tsp. baking soda
1/4 tsp. salt
about 1/3 cup crumbled cereal (like raisin bran or fiber one)
1.) Preheat oven to 350*F. Spray a 8″ inch square glass baking pan with non-stick cooking spray.
2.) Combine sugar, honey, yogurt, banana, egg, oil and milk until smooth.
3.) Stir in dry ingredients (except for cereal). Fold in raisins.
4.) Pour mixture into the baking pan. Sprinkle the top with the crumbled cereal.
5.) Bake for 25 – 30 minutes.
6.) Allow to cool then slice into 9 squares. If you’re traveling, wrap the squares in foil. I keep them in the fridge until I’m ready to hit the road just to keep them fresh.
